Shoot Without Worrying About the Shake

The headline feature here is the 50-megapixel No Shake Camera. It's a 50-megapixel wide-angle lens with built-in OIS, which stands for optical image stabilisation. In simple terms, it physically corrects for hand movement while you're filming, so you don't end up with wobbly footage every time you walk, run, or film while laughing.

Selfies and Video Calls That Actually Look Good

The front camera is a 12-megapixel sensor built for HDR, which means it balances bright and dark areas in a single shot better than a standard camera would. So if you're filming a selfie video near a window or on a bright afternoon, your face doesn't get washed out or lost in shadow. It works the same way for video calls, so you look clear whether you're catching up with friends or sitting through an online class.

Speed That Doesn't Slow Down Your Process

None of this matters if your phone lags while you're shooting or editing. The Galaxy A27 5G runs on a Snapdragon processor paired with LPDDR5X RAM, which gives you 50% higher data transfer speed compared to older memory. In practical terms, that means faster app launches, quicker camera processing, and smoother multitasking when you're jumping between the camera, Gallery, and your social apps to post.
